Is it correct that the GRE test in January of any year is the easiest and the difficulty level rises every month from there?

What is considered a good score in IELTS?

Though it’s a popular myth but that’s not at all true. The GRE is a standardized test conducted by Educational Testing Services (ETS) to test student’s abilities in different sections like Mathematics and Verbal. As it is a computer adaptive test, the level of problems changes according to the performance in the previous section.
If the level of the exam would have been different in different months, the whole concept of testing aspirants from different academic backgrounds on a common parameter would have got nullified.

IELTS scores range from 1 to 9 (non-user to expert). You will be given a band score from 1 to 9 for each section of the test – Reading, Listening, Writing & Speaking. 6 is termed as a competent score while anything above 7 is considered a good score in IELTS.

can i join masters course in GERMANY, without learning german

In Germany, you do not need proficiency in Germany for a Master’s degree. There are many English-taught programs. However, some programs may require a B1 or B2 German proficiency. The requirement is not for every course and is asked only for select courses. You’ll be fine for the most part if you are from the STEM field.
But having knowledge of German language is definitely going to help you professionally and personally as well. To better integrate with German society, it is recommended to get some basic knowledge of the language. Even though it is not required by your program, it will be beneficial to you.

Medical education abroad is very different from medical education here in India. In North America, for example, it takes a lot longer to complete medical education than it does in India. In India, you can jump to a medical degree right after college. But that is not so in America. You’ll have to do an undergraduate degree, called Pre-Med. After that, you’ll have to do a Medical degree for your masters.
